Scamander Vallis is an ancient river valley in the Arabia quadrangle of Mars,{{Cite web|work=Gazetteer of Planetary Nomenclature|title=Scamander Vallis|url=https://planetarynames.wr.usgs.gov/Feature/5353?__fsk=870215144}} located at coordinates 16ºN, 28.5ºE. It is 204 km long and was named after an ancient name of a river in Troy.{{cite web |url=http://planetarynames.wr.usgs.gov/ |title=Home |website=planetarynames.wr.usgs.gov}}
